회원 등급별로 관리지 페이지 메뉴 설정하는 방법이 있나요??

회원 등급별로 관리지 페이지 메뉴 설정하는 방법이 있나요??

QA

회원 등급별로 관리지 페이지 메뉴 설정하는 방법이 있나요??

답변 1

본문

관리자 페이지 로그인까지는 수정을 했는데.. 그 이후 어떻게 설정을 해야 할지 궁금합니다.

 

저기에서 오류가 나네요 ㅠㅠ

 

function print_menu2($key, $no='')
{
    global $menu, $auth_menu, $is_admin, $auth, $g5, $sub_menu;

    
    
    $str .= "<ul>";
    for($i=1; $i<count($menu[$key]); $i++)
    {
        if (($is_admin != 'super' && (!array_key_exists($menu[$key][$i][0],$auth) || !strstr($auth[$menu[$key][$i][0]], 'r'))) || $mb_level != '10)
            continue;

        if (($menu[$key][$i][4] == 1 && $gnb_grp_style == false) || ($menu[$key][$i][4] != 1 && $gnb_grp_style == true)) $gnb_grp_div = 'gnb_grp_div';
        else $gnb_grp_div = '';

        if ($menu[$key][$i][4] == 1) $gnb_grp_style = 'gnb_grp_style';
        else $gnb_grp_style = '';

        $current_class = '';

        if ($menu[$key][$i][0] == $sub_menu){
            $current_class = ' on';
        }

        $str .= '<li data-menu="'.$menu[$key][$i][0].'"><a href="'.$menu[$key][$i][2].'" class="gnb_2da '.$gnb_grp_style.' '.$gnb_grp_div.$current_class.'">'.$menu[$key][$i][1].'</a></li>';

        $auth_menu[$menu[$key][$i][0]] = $menu[$key][$i][1];
    }
    $str .= "</ul>";

    return $str;
}
 

이 질문에 댓글 쓰기 :

답변 1

if ($is_admin != 'super' && (!array_key_exists($menu[$key][$i][0],$auth) || !strstr($auth[$menu[$key][$i][0]], 'r')) && $mb_level != '10)

            continue;

위에 부분을 수정해보세요.. 괄호를 주의하세요..

답변을 작성하시기 전에 로그인 해주세요.
QA 내용 검색
질문등록
전체 332
© SIRSOFT
현재 페이지 제일 처음으로